Shreya Ghoshal is a singer known for her wide vocal range and versatility.

She grew up in Rawatbhata, a small town near Kota, Rajasthan.

She began learning music at the age of 4 and took professional training at the age of 6.

As she won the television singing competition Sa Re Ga Ma, she caught the attention of director Sanjay Leela Bhansali's mother.

She made her Bollywood playback singing debut with Bhansali's romantic drama Devdas for which she received multiple awards.

She has been honoured by the state of Ohio in the United States, where Governor Ted Strickland declared 26 June 2010 as "Shreya Ghoshal Day".

She got married to her school friend and boyfriend, Shiladitya Mukhopadhyaya.

The couple tied the knot on 5 February 2015.

The couple had a son named Devyaan Mukhopadhyaya.

She has recorded film songs in 12 different Indian Languages.

She has recorded more than 1000 songs in different languages.

Her first-ever recorded song was "Ganraj Rangi Nachato".
